后端开发和云计算运维哪个好?零基础应该选哪个?

IT行业中有许多岗位,其中开发、测试和运维是大众最为熟知的3个工种。这三大工种也是人们入行IT最优先选择的岗位。其中后端开发和云计算运维最为火热。

对于有意向进入IT领域的学习者来说,面临的一个关键问题就是:在后端开发和云计算运维之间,哪个好?应该如何选择?

首先来看看这两个岗位

一、后端开发:构建系统的核心

后端开发,主要负责应用程序的服务器、数据库和应用程序的核心逻辑。后端开发者使用各种编程语言(如Java、Python、Go、Node.js等)来创建和维护系统的核心功能。

后端开发的关键技能:

  • 编程能力:熟练掌握至少一种后端编程语言。
  • 数据库管理:能够设计、优化和管理数据库。
  • 系统设计:理解并能设计高性能、高可用性的系统架构。
  • API开发:构建和维护应用程序编程接口(API)。

二、云计算运维:确保系统的稳定运行

云计算运维工程师负责维护云服务的基础设施,确保云资源的稳定、安全和高效运行。他们需要对云平台(如AWS、Azure、Google Cloud等)有深入的了解,并能够进行自动化运维和监控。

云计算运维的关键技能:

  • 云平台管理:熟悉至少一种主流的云服务平台。
  • 自动化脚本编写:使用Shell、Python等编写自动化脚本。
  • 系统监控:部署和使用监控工具来跟踪系统性能和健康状态。
  • 安全配置:管理和配置云安全,包括网络、IAM和数据加密。

三、如何选择

在选择后端开发和云计算运维之间,可以考虑以下几个因素:

  1. 兴趣所在:对编程和算法感兴趣可以选择后端开发,对系统管理和云计算平台感兴趣可以选择云计算运维。

  2. 职业发展:后端开发更偏向于软件开发,而云计算运维则偏向于系统运营和架构优化。

  3. 学习难度:开发普遍比运维要求高,难度大。同理,如果你基础薄弱,那么我建议你学习云计算运维。

  4. 工作内容:后端开发更多关注应用逻辑的实现,而云计算运维则关注系统的稳定性和性能。

  5. 就业机会:两者都有广阔的就业市场,但具体需求可能因地区和行业发展而异。

  6. 薪资水平:两者都能提供有竞争力的薪资,但具体薪资水平也会受到个人技能、工作经验和地区经济状况的影响。

结语

后端开发和云计算运维各有优势,选择时应基于个人的兴趣、职业规划和市场需求。无论选择哪个方向,都需要持续学习和实践,不断提升个人技能。记住,技术是不断进步的,只有不断适应和学习,才能在IT行业保持竞争力。

说在最后

如果你有系统学习云计算运维的打算,可以去看我之前的这篇文章:

云计算运维工程师有前景吗?好多机构哪家好一点?-CSDN博客

重磅!2024年国内Linux云计算培训机构前6名最新出炉啦!-CSDN博客

  • 9
    点赞
  • 10
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值